pSeven Enterprise v2023.08 Release
pSeven development team announces the release of pSeven Enterprise v2023.08, a new version of our low code cloud-native collaborative platform for building, deploying and operating different models and processes at scale. This release contains many changes, the most important of which are below.
Updates
- You can automate publishing workflows to AppsHub using the pSeven Enterprise REST API.
- FMI support via FMPy. The fmpy module is available in Python script blocks and user blocks.
- While block: no longer in beta. No new issues have been discovered during the extended stability testing period of the block, so its current version is considered stable.
Deployment and administration
- The "on-demand" block execution strategy is now default for new deployments, as it appears to be the preferred configuration choice in most of the known use-cases. The "all-at-once" strategy is now an option, supported for backwards compatibility.
- Added an experimental feature to run workflow blocks natively on Kubernetes. When enabled, pSeven Enterprise creates a Pod for each running block instance, instead of placing blocks into slots provided by task executors.
